DIRECT ADMISSIONS EXERCISE (<strong>DAE</strong>) <strong>2013</strong>SINGAPORE-CAMBRIDGE GCE ‘O’ LEVEL / IGCSEAPPLYING <strong>FOR</strong> HEALTH SCIENCES (NURSING)<strong>INSTRUCTION</strong> SHEETSECTION A – GENERAL <strong>INSTRUCTION</strong>SPlease read the following notes carefully.1. To apply through the Direct Admissions Exercise (<strong>DAE</strong>), use this form if you have the following qualifications:• Singapore-Cambridge GCE ‘O’ Level holder• IGCSE holder (Singapore School System)2. The following persons should NOT apply under this exercise:• Former / current polytechnic students.• Holders of qualifications other than Singapore-Cambridge GCE ‘O’ Levels and IGCSE.3. To be eligible for consideration, you must meet the entry requirements of Health Sciences (Nursing) course. The entry requirements can befound online @ www.np.edu.sg/hs/courses/hsn/Pages/<strong>HSN</strong>.aspx#entryrequirements4. Application period: 21 – 25 Mar <strong>2013</strong>. Late submissions will NOT be considered. Application forms are only accepted DURING theapplication period.5. Selection is based on academic merit and the decision by the Board of Admissions is final.6. Supporting documentsThe application form should be submitted with copies of the relevant documents in the following order:(a) GCE ‘O’ Level Results(d) Proof of CCA Grade (if any)(b) IGCSE Results(e) Other supporting documents*(c) Other Examination Results (if any)* Where applicable7. Applicants are not required to pay any application fee upfront. The application fee will be paid together with other school fees in theevent that the student gains admission and accepts the offer8. Fees (International Students)The total fees of a full-time student, without subsidy from the Singapore Government, are above $19,000 per year subject torevision each year. The Singapore Government provides tuition grant to assist students in paying their tuition fees. Internationalstudents who accept the tuition grant need only to pay about 20% of the total fees but will be bonded to work in Singapore for 3years upon completion of their courses. Those who wish to pay the full fees can opt to reject the government tuition grant.2. Tuition Grant IneligibilityApplicants who have received tuition grants and completed their first year of study in a local university would not be entitled to fulltuition grant.3. Place Reserved on NS GroundsSingaporean / Singapore PR male applicants who are unable to commence their studies starting 15 Apr <strong>2013</strong> on grounds ofNational Service may request to have their place reserved upon the offer of admission.
